Birthday Banger by Cannarado Genetics

Indica genetics × Sativa genetics

Birthday Banger is a hybrid strain developed by Cannarado Genetics, recognized for its balanced indica and sativa characteristics. It was introduced to the market and quickly gained acclaim for its consistent yields and robust growth. The strain is designed to provide a potent experience suitable for special occasions.

Appearance

Birthday Banger buds are typically dense and compact, covered in a generous amount of trichomes that give them a frosted appearance. They often display deep green coloration, accented by purple hues and vibrant orange pistils, contributing to their striking visual appeal.

The structure of the buds is well-cured and sticky, indicative of high resin production. Their morphology is often described as dense, with an elegant symmetry enhanced by careful cultivation and trimming.

Aroma & Flavor

The aroma of Birthday Banger is a complex blend featuring earthy, sweet, and spicy notes that are long-lasting. Analytical reports suggest high levels of myrcene and caryophyllene contribute to its warm, musky scent, which can evolve to include floral and citrusy undertones as the buds mature.

Its flavor profile is equally intriguing, combining a creamy, dessert-like sweetness with a robust herbal base. Users often note a subtle berry-like sweetness alongside a hint of spiciness, creating a palatable and unique taste experience that is both smooth and inviting.

Terpenes & Cannabinoids

Laboratory analyses indicate that Birthday Banger typically contains THC levels ranging from 20% to 25% under optimal growing conditions, classifying it as a high-potency variety. The strain's aromatic profile is influenced by terpenes such as myrcene and caryophyllene.

While specific CBD percentages are not detailed, the focus is on the balanced cannabinoid profile that contributes to its well-rounded effects. The meticulous breeding process ensures a consistent cannabinoid and terpene expression.
